Cypress Hills Local Development Corporation has an opening for a full-time Teacher Assistant in the United Community Centers Early Learning Center Program. The teacher assistant is responsible for supporting a learning environment based on the Creative Curriculum approach that helps the children develop physically, emotionally, socially, cognitively and creatively. They are responsible for complying with procedural norms, standards of attendance, and daycare regulations . Supervised by the UCC Early Learning Center Program Director, the assistant teacher helps make the center a warm, welcoming environment.
  • Principal
  • Duties: Ensure a learning environment based on the Creative Curriculum approach that helps the children develop physically, emotionally, socially, cognitively, and creatively. Support the implementation of activities that will promote social, emotional, cognitive, physical and creative development of children. Adhere to all DOE Performance standards in addition to the Agency mandates of United Community Day Care center. Assume responsibility for the operation of the classroom, in the absence of the Group Teacher. Share job related knowledge with team members so as to promote and support their professional growth. Participate in regularly scheduled staff & team meetings, classroom development workshops on and off site as well as training conducted by UCDCC, ACS and other funders. Performs center-related services/activities such as parent/teacher conferences, transition meetings, end of year celebrations, etc. Share information regarding children and the program with parents via daily contact and informal/formal interfacings, newsletters, etc. Encourage parents in their role as their children’s primary teachers by acting as resource person (i.e.: disseminating information, actively listening to parents, offering suggestions, etc.). Establish and maintain positive relationships with parents/families via open communications, training and other developmental activities. Assist with written observations, progress reports, outcomes reporting, and other documents relevant to the tracking of children’s progress. Assist Group Teachers utilize information obtained via observations, conferences, tracking, etc. to design developmentally appropriate and individualized lesson plans.   • Requirements: The assistant teacher shall meet the requirements set by the Agency for the NYC Department of Education. Be at least eighteen years old. Possess a high school diploma or equivalent (GED). Hold a valid Level 1 or higher NY State Teaching Assistant certification or a Child Development Associate (CDA) credential. Must clear DOE fingerprinting and background authorizations. Daily access to reliable transportation to Brooklyn, NY.
  • Supervision

    Reports directly to UCC Early Learning Center Program Director.
